2026年大数据分析clickhouse核心要点_第1页
2026年大数据分析clickhouse核心要点_第2页
2026年大数据分析clickhouse核心要点_第3页
2026年大数据分析clickhouse核心要点_第4页
2026年大数据分析clickhouse核心要点_第5页
已阅读5页,还剩3页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

PAGE2026年大数据分析clickhouse核心要点实用文档·2026年版2026年

2026年大数据分析ClickHouse核心要点一、ClickHouse引擎的海上失踪73%的企业在ClickHouse的引擎设置阶段忽略了关键参数,导致性能降低30%以上。去年8月,做运营的小陈在总结一个ClickHouse集群的故障时发现了这个问题。他花了1周时间调整参数,从2600元/小时的运行费用降低到了800元/小时。你也在面对高成本的数据查询延时吗?这篇文章提供「精确的优化步骤」,让你在30分钟内完成性能提升。1.引擎调优的"看不见的手"(1)初始化GPU内存点击ClickHouse控制台→选择集群→点击「可用资源」→设置GPU内存至少为16G(2)分散查询执行编辑配置文件config.xml→找到max_threads变量→将值调整至CPU核数的1.5倍(3)优化磁盘访问切换到「集群视图」→「分片」→「列族」→设置maxopenfiles至1000以上微型故事:小陈的优化案例去年9月,小陈的ClickHouse集群每天处理超10亿查询,但高峰期间常常出现查询超时。通过调整上述参数后,平均查询时间从300ms降低到了80ms。待续2.引擎调优的"看得见的手"小陈通过调整引擎参数后,取得了显著的提升,但他并没有停下脚步。他继续优化ClickHouse集群的配置,希望能够获得更好的性能。小陈发现,ClickHouse集群中的节点数和CPU核数的配置并不匹配。他决定调整节点数,使其与CPU核数相匹配。经过调整后,小陈发现,集群的性能提升了20%。他还发现,调整了max_threads变量后,集群的并发查询能力也大大提高了。小陈的经验表明,调整引擎参数和配置是获得ClickHouse集群最佳性能的关键一步。●可复制行动:确保ClickHouse集群中的节点数与CPU核数相匹配。调整max_threads变量至CPU核数的1.5倍以上。检查并调整maxopenfiles变量至1000以上。●反直觉发现:ClickHouse集群中的节点数与CPU核数的匹配度不重要,反而CPU核数的使用率是关键。max_threads变量的调整对集群的并发查询能力有着重要的影响。注意:上述操作应在测试环境中进行,以避免影响生产环境的性能。3.ClickHouse集群的磁盘配置优化小陈在调整引擎参数后,又发现了另一个瓶颈——磁盘访问的效率。ClickHouse集群中的磁盘配置不合理,导致读写速度过慢。小陈决定调整磁盘配置,以提高读写速度。他选择了NVMeSSD硬盘,并设置了合理的块大小和缓冲区大小。经过调整后,小陈发现,磁盘访问的速度提升了50%。他还发现,调整了块大小和缓冲区大小后,读写速度的差异大大减小。小陈的经验表明,磁盘配置是ClickHouse集群性能的重要组成部分。●可复制行动:选择NVMeSSD硬盘作为存储设备。设置合理的块大小和缓冲区大小。检查并调整磁盘配置,以确保最佳的读写速度。●反直觉发现:ClickHouse集群中的磁盘配置对性能有着重要的影响。块大小和缓冲区大小的调整对读写速度的影响不可忽视。3.2ClickHouse集群的磁盘配置优化3.2.1可复制行动选择NVMeSSD硬盘作为存储设备。设置合理的块大小和缓冲区大小。检查并调整磁盘配置,以确保最佳的读写速度。3.2.2反直觉发现ClickHouse集群中的磁盘配置对性能有着重要的影响。块大小和缓冲区大小的调整对读写速度的影响不可忽视。小陈还发现,当块大小和缓冲区大小设置不合理时,读写速度会出现严重的差异。这是因为ClickHouse集群会根据块大小和缓冲区大小来决定如何分配磁盘资源,因此,如果设置不合理,会导致磁盘资源分配不均,从而导致读写速度差异。3.3ClickHouse集群的网络配置优化小陈在调整磁盘配置后,又发现了另一个瓶颈——网络访问的效率。ClickHouse集群中的网络配置不合理,导致数据传输速度过慢。小陈决定调整网络配置,以提高数据传输速度。他选择了高性能的网卡,并设置了合理的网络参数。经过调整后,小陈发现,数据传输速度提升了30%。3.3.1可复制行动选择高性能的网卡作为网络设备。设置合理的网络参数。检查并调整网络配置,以确保最佳的数据传输速度。3.3.2反直觉发现ClickHouse集群中的网络配置对性能有着重要的影响。网络参数的调整对数据传输速度的影响不可忽视。小陈还发现,当网络参数设置不合理时,数据传输速度会出现严重的差异。这是因为ClickHouse集群会根据网络参数来决定如何分配网络资源,因此,如果设置不合理,会导致网络资源分配不均,从而导致数据传输速度差异。3.4ClickHouse集群的内存配置优化小陈在调整网络配置后,又发现了另一个瓶颈——内存的使用率。ClickHouse集群中的内存配置不合理,导致内存溢出。小陈决定调整内存配置,以提高内存使用率。他选择了高容量的内存,并设置了合理的内存参数。经过调整后,小陈发现,内存使用率提升了40%。3.4.1可复制行动选择高容量的内存作为内存设备。设置合理的内存参数。检查并调整内存配置,以确保最佳的内存使用率。3.4.2反直觉发现ClickHouse集群中的内存配置对性能有着重要的影响。内存参数的调整对内存使用率的影响不可忽视。小陈还发现,当内存参数设置不合理时,内存溢出会出现严重的问题。这是因为ClickHouse集群会根据内存参数来决定如何分配内存资源,因此,如果设置不合理,会导致内存资源分配不均,从而导致内存溢出。ClickHouse集群的配置优化是一个复杂的过程,需要仔细考虑各个方面的影响。通过调整引擎参数、磁盘配置、网络配置和内存配置,可以显著提高ClickHouse集群的性能。3.5ClickHouse集群的磁盘配置优化小陈继续优化ClickHouse集群的磁盘配置。他发现,ClickHouse集群中的磁盘配置不合理,导致磁盘的读写速度非常慢。小陈决定调整磁盘配置,以提高磁盘的读写速度。他选择了高效的磁盘阵列,并设置了合理的磁盘参数。经过调整后,小陈发现,磁盘的读写速度提升了60%。这使得ClickHouse集群的查询速度得到了显著的提高。3.5.1可复制行动选择高效的磁盘阵列作为磁盘设备。设置合理的磁盘参数。检查并调整磁盘配置,以确保最佳的磁盘读写速度。3.5.2反直觉发现ClickHouse集群中的磁盘配置对性能有着重要的影响。磁盘参数的调整对磁盘读写速度的影响不可忽视。小陈还发现,当磁盘参数设置不合理时,磁盘的读写速度会出现严重的问题。这是因为ClickHouse集群会根据磁盘参数来决定如何分配磁盘资源,导致磁盘资源分配不均,导致磁盘的读写速度减慢。3.6ClickHouse集群的配置监控和调整小陈还意识到,ClickHouse集群的配置监控和调整是非常重要的。他决定使用ClickHouse集群的监控工具来监控集群的性能,包括磁盘读写速度、内存使用率、网络传输速度等。通过监控工具,小陈发现,某个节点的磁盘读写速度较慢,内存使用率较高。小陈决定调整该节点的磁盘配置和内存参数,以提高磁盘读写速度和内存使用率。经过调整后,小陈发现,该节点的磁盘读写速度和内存使用率都得到了显著的提高。这种方式使得ClickHouse集群的性能得到持续的提高。3.6.1可复制行动

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论